Bollywood actor at the age of 89 on November 24 Dharmendra He passed away. His departure has shocked everyone from his family to his fans. Dharmendra’s blockbuster “Sholay” re-released in theaters on December 12. 50 years after that film was loved by the fans, now, there is another big news for the late actor’s fans. Dharmendra’s hit movie “Yamla Pagla Deewana” will be released in theaters again. His fans are very excited to watch this movie. Let’s know when is Dharmendra’s movie “Yamla Pagla Deewana” releasing.
Dharmendra’s movie “Yamla Pagla Deewana” released in 2011 and received good response at the box office. In the film, Dharmendra, his two sons, Sunny Deol And Bobby Deol had worked. This father-son trio made people laugh a lot. According to a report in “Bollywood Hungama”, “Yamla Pagla Deewana” will be released in theaters again. Dharmendra’s Smritiprityartha is an old film to be released on 1st January 2026. The rights of “Yamla Pagla Deewana” are held by NH Studios. The film was originally slated to release on December 19, but the release date has been postponed due to the positive response to “Dhurandhar”. The company is gearing up for a release in the new year. It is worth noting that “Yamla Pagla Deewana” starring Dharmendra, Sunny Deol and Bobby Deol was directed by Sameer Karnik. After Dharmendra, Sunny Deol, Bobby Deol’s movie ‘Yamla Pagla Deewana’, the movie ‘Yamla Pagla Deewana 2’ hit the theaters in 2013 and the movie ‘Yamla Pagla Deewana’ hit the theaters in 2018.

Dharmendra’s last film “Ikkij” is slated to hit the theaters on December 25. Amitabh Bachchan’s grandson Agastya Nanda will be seen in the film. The film “Ikkij” is based on a true incident and depicts the life story of Param Vir Chakra winner Arun Khetrapal. Dharmendra will play the role of Agastya Nanda’s father in the film. The death of the veteran actor just a month before the release of the film “Ikkij” left many of his well-wishers heartbroken.
